Blum buys 458,038 shares of Avid Technology

By Lisa Kerner

Charlotte, N.C., March 4 - Investors led by Blum Capital Partners, LP acquired 458,038 shares of Avid Technology Inc. between Feb. 20 and March 3 priced from $9.7146 to $10.0116 each, according to a schedule 13D/A fil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Between Feb. 12 and Feb. 19, Blum bought 541,963 shares of Avid Technology priced from $10.002 to $10.325 each, a prior SEC filing said.

Blum and its affiliates beneficially own 8,931,530 shares, or 24.1%, of the Tewksbury, Mass., digital media content provider's stock.
